Stucco Water Damage Repair Cost in Littletown, AZ

The cost of Stucco Water Damage Repair can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Littletown, AZ.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and developing a plan for repair. Here are some typical price ranges for common services related to Stucco Water Damage Repair: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, amount of water extracted.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, complexity of drying process.
Repair and Reconstruction $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of materials needed.
Final Inspection and Clean-up $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of clean-up process.
Moisture Testing and Inspection $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, complexity of inspection process.

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and a detailed plan for repair. Our team will work with you to develop a customized plan and provide a free estimate for the work.

How do I prevent Stucco Water Damage?

Preventing Stucco Water Damage needs regular maintenance and inspections. Our team recommends checking your stucco regularly for signs of damage, such as cracks, warping, or discoloration. You should also ensure that your gutters and downspouts are clear and functioning properly, and that your roof is in good condition. By taking these steps, you can help prevent Stucco Water Damage and keep your home safe and secure.
